JUDGMENT [Judgment per : Rajendra Menon, CJ (Oral)]. - Seeking release of a vehicle (Mahindra Pick Up Van) seized by the authorities of Basopatti Police Station, District - Madhubani bearing Registration No. BR-07-GA 2976 in connection with Basopatti P.S. Case No. 152/17 for the offences under Sections 7, 11 and 51 of the Custom....

....e Foreign Trade (Development and Regulation) Act and under Section 414 of the Indian Penal Code. 3. It is further the case of the State Government and the police authorities that they found the vehicle to be crossing the border without valid document and, therefore, finding violation of the statutory provision the vehicle has been seized.
